Greuel released first audit
The Los Angeles Convention Center wasted more than $1 million in taxpayer money by failing to properly control employee overtime and lacks a system for keeping track of its fixed assets, some of which could not be found, according to an audit released on Thursday.Daily News
The audit -- the first by new City Controller Wendy Greuel -- also found that the convention center has no clear policy or oversight of fee waivers. It also recommended that a flexible demand-based pricing program be implemented, allowing management to fill the Convention Center during slower times by reducing rental prices.
